matplotlib.pyplot.legend

matplotlib.pyplot.legend 这个函数用来设置画的线的图例。

如图中的左上角的就是图例,用来指示不同的图的名称等信息,这里只画了个散点的scatter, 取名就SamplePoint1:

 

这个小程序有意思的地方在label里如果用$$把字符串围起来,那字符串里的空格会去掉,非第一个下划线会把后面的一个字符做为下标,如果下划线在整个字符串的最前面,那这个图例中这个线/点的名字这行就不会显示。

关于legend还有很多参数,官网上有详细的参数说明:

http://matplotlib.org/api/pyplot_api.html#matplotlib.pyplot.legend

还有使用说明:

http://matplotlib.org/users/legend_guide.html#plotting-guide-legend

 

一个例子:

 

例子:

例子:

打赏